Future Rotorcraft Technologies

The laboratory develops technologies for manned or Uncrewed rotary wing platforms, aimed at making design and certification processes more efficient, improving mission capability and reducing operating costs, to meet today’s requirements for urban air mobility and decarbonisation.

The laboratory studies multiple areas: advanced modelling, simulation and Digital Twin solutions, Artificial Intelligence-based functions to support autonomous flight, external environment perception and onboard diagnostics, the electrification of propulsion systems (including the use of hydrogen combustion cells), the development of innovative coatings to reduce wear in extreme conditions, and the damage mechanisms in the composite materials of rotors.
